首頁>Club>
12
回覆列表
  • 1 # 大情小事01

    出現此問題可以參考如下解決方法:

    用這個maya自帶的材質substance(物質)給一個多變形平面賦材質,有很多地面的材質,自帶法線貼圖,可以多項調節。然後調節物理天空的地平面位置往下調,再加個流體雲,自帶的就行,在visor裡選擇,放大,渲染

  • 2 # 扣丁格子

    遊戲開發是一個籠統的說法,包含很多細分類別。大體可以分為遊戲前端開發和遊戲後端開發。

    遊戲前端開發:

    遊戲前端我們可以理解為手機上面安裝的遊戲APP,或者ipad、PC電腦電腦上面執行的遊戲程式。

    遊戲前端開發涉及到很多細分類別, 具體如下:

    平面美術: 主要是設計2維影象,比如人物角色圖片,揹包裡面展示的物品,以及人物對話方塊,血條以及其他圖片。主要使用手繪,PS處理等方式。3D美術: 主要是進行模型的設計,比如人物模型,槍械模型,建築物模型,車輛模型,敵人,怪獸等物體。使用3DMAX、Maya、ZBrush等軟體。特效製作: 主要進行各種特效的設計製作。比如打擊特效,例子特效,大招特效,煙火特效,聲音特效等。使用專業的遊戲引擎比如 Unity,UE4等遊戲開發引擎設計。策劃設計: 策劃設計主要是設計遊戲情節,關卡特色,闖關激勵等。軟體開發: 軟體開發人員就是將各種資源和策劃設計的想法、使用程式語言將其實現。最終呈現出來我們玩的遊戲。

    上述分類每一個都是專業方向,都需要專業知識去完成。

    遊戲後端開發:

    後端開發一般是聯網遊戲才有,單機版本的遊戲是沒有後端開發。後端開發主要是將每個玩家進行互聯,比如組隊開黑,百人吃雞等都離不開後端開發。

    遊戲後端開發涉及到網路通訊,資訊保安,遊戲防作弊處理,資料庫服務等專業知識。這些知識是可以透過程式語言搞定的。程式語言有很多,比如 C++,Java,Python等諸多程式語言。

    進行遊戲開發,就得先知道自己喜歡那個細分,比如3D設計、前端程式設計、特效製作、還是後端開發等。確定了自己的方向,才能有後期的學習規劃。才知道後期應該學習什麼,怎麼學?哪些學習才是最高效的。

    有什麼不明白或者不瞭解的,可以問我“長有一頭秀髮的”程式猿。

  • 3 # zan啦啦啦

    你好,遊戲開發是一個過程,主要包括原畫創作、建模、材質、燈光及渲染、人物骨骼設定、動畫、特效等部分。涉及範疇包括 :遊戲規則及玩法、視覺藝術、程式設計、產品化、聲效配音、劇情編劇、遊戲角色、道具、場景、介面等等元素。

    產研是指為了一個產品更好的發展,所需要涉及的一切內容,包括推廣、更新迭代等,更專注於研究。

    開發指工程師,負責交付的人員,更專注於開發。

    好的產品經理一定要懂產品懂使用者,如果產品是年輕人使用的,互動風格就應符合年輕人的使用感受;如果是中老年使用的,那應以簡約為主。

    資訊收集階段

    Pocket:在產品定義環節,用 Pocket 收集行業、競品等資訊。

    需求分析

    MindNode:用思維導圖梳理產品的整體框架和演進步驟。XMind 在 Windows 上或許值得推崇,但 Mac 上那種卡頓的體驗彷彿讓人一秒齣戲 Windows 98。

    Numbers:一款被忽略的 Mac 原生應用,主要用於資料分析,等比 Office 套件中的 Excel。不過在分析功能上 Numbers 一直處於被 Excel 吊打的狀態,資料分析師對它更是一臉嫌棄。但日常分析 Numbers 足以應付,內建的某些公式好用到飛起,加上排版性很強,作為一個表格工具也可以有很好的表達力。

    方案輸出

    Keynote:這個階段中我需要將想法呈現給不同受眾群體來透過產品立項。 Keynote 中的「神奇移動」,能夠清晰直觀的演示一件事物的前後邏輯,效果驚人。Keynote 也是我這幾年最最最愛的應用,完美得無懈可擊!

    業務建模

    Axure RP:產品經理的必備飯碗,流程、用例、場景、原型圖都用 Axure 完成,曾經也嘗試過 Sketch 畫原型,效果也還不錯,只是在 Sketch 上建模還是特別容易陷入互動的誤區,恍然一剎那感覺是名設計師。

    藍湖:一鍵透過連結分享功能,省去很多傳送的時間,連線和標註功能簡直不能更好用,是設計師推薦給我用的,一秒愛上。

    專案計劃

    OmniPlan:接觸最多的專案管理工具,簡單的專案計劃用 Excel,複雜和長期專案就使用 OmniPlan。

    任務管理

    Things:Things 也是今年發現的好物之一,Things 的使用覆蓋了產品規劃的各個過程,每日的任務計劃透過它進行管理。

    藍湖:藍湖也有任務管理的功能,但不能覆蓋已經完成專案,這一點到不影響使用,比起Things更適用於多團隊、多專案協同,系統也更穩定。

    工具終歸為「人」服務,善假於物可以減少工作環境中的噪音,使我們變得更專注,以此提升效率加速產出。不過最終要做出一款好產品,靠的還是對使用者的洞察與尊重。但有了這些好工具的加持,我們往往就有了一個好的開始。

  • 4 # 娜是一種幸福

    遊戲開發本身也是軟體開發1、基礎公共課:遊戲概述 Photoshop平面軟體及畫素美術 3dsmax軟體基礎及效果圖製作 遊戲程式設計基礎及遊戲製作原理 遊戲策劃、製作、測試及運營實踐 遊戲行業規劃及職業素質。2、專業技能課:手機2D遊戲開發 2D遊戲開發技術實戰 C++語言及演算法基礎 WIN32程式開發及MFC基礎 2D遊戲開發實踐 行業規劃及職業素質。2D網路遊戲開發主要學習內容有網路遊戲程式設計、網路遊戲演算法設計、2D網路遊戲平臺設計以及商業實戰專案訓練,包含C++、資料結構、演算法基礎、Windows API使用、MFC原理及其應用、2D圖形渲染技術、介面設計與應用。3、遊戲程式方向: Direct 3D程式開發基礎 3D遊戲開發技術實戰

  • 5 # 墨陽莫楊

    1、PC 類端遊(就是電腦上面執行的遊戲)

    這類遊戲線上人數多,遊戲中要處理的資料龐大。所以對伺服器效能要求非常高,一般都是採用C++ 做為開發語言,C++ 可以直接操作記憶體資料,與作業系統直接互動,減少資料之間的複製,它執行效率高,處理速度快,是很適合這裡遊戲開發語言。

    學習這種遊戲的開發,學習的有 C++ 程式設計,Linux 網路程式設計、TCP/IP 通訊協議、多執行緒程式設計再加資料庫。

    PC 類端遊戲開發週期較長。大概需要三年左右的時間。

    2、網頁遊戲(比如現在經常說的 1 刀 999 級)

    因為是網頁遊戲,遊戲的介面展示依賴於網路傳輸,所在在畫面和特效上會次於客戶端遊戲很多。和端遊類是差不多是一樣的,有些公司之前是做端遊的,他們就直接把端遊的伺服器架構拿來就可以使用,以完成快速開發。

    需要學習內容和端遊差不多。

    3、手機遊戲(主要區分為安卓和 IOS)

    手機類遊戲目前是最熱門的遊戲,很多熱播的電視劇或者電影之後,都會有相同情節的手游上線。

    伺服器主流的開發語言是 C++ 和 Java,但是 C++ 學習難度大,開發速度慢。一般來說我們都是使用Java語言來開發伺服器。

  • 6 # 烏魯木齊新華學校

    現在計算機相關專業都很熱門,網際網路+的時代各行各業發展都離不開點電腦,所以當然是學網際網路IT技術好了。網際網路是目前熱門行業,將來發展前景也是非常有前途的。

  • 7 # luo互聯之學無止境

    根據遊戲型別的不同,所學的軟體也不一樣。

    中小型遊戲大致可分為網頁遊戲,flash遊戲,小遊戲等,基本上都是一些休閒類的傻呆萌的情節和操作。

    這類遊戲開發相對比較簡單,會 Javascript、HTML、flashcs、Java 就可以進行開發了,語言類主要有 C / C++,組合語言,著色器語言,指令碼語言,高效的開發語言 C# 或 Java 。

    現在的遊戲主要分為三種:

    1、PC 類端遊(就是電腦上面執行的遊戲)

    這類遊戲線上人數多,遊戲中要處理的資料龐大。所以對伺服器效能要求非常高,一般都是採用C++ 做為開發語言,C++ 可以直接操作記憶體資料,與作業系統直接互動,減少資料之間的複製,它執行效率高,處理速度快,是很適合這裡遊戲開發語言。

    學習這種遊戲的開發,學習的有 C++ 程式設計,Linux 網路程式設計、TCP/IP 通訊協議、多執行緒程式設計再加資料庫。

    PC 類端遊戲開發週期較長。大概需要三年左右的時間。

    2、網頁遊戲(比如現在經常說的 1 刀 999 級)

    因為是網頁遊戲,遊戲的介面展示依賴於網路傳輸,所在在畫面和特效上會次於客戶端遊戲很多。和端遊類是差不多是一樣的,有些公司之前是做端遊的,他們就直接把端遊的伺服器架構拿來就可以使用,以完成快速開發。

    需要學習內容和端遊差不多。

    3、手機遊戲(主要區分為安卓和 IOS)

    手機類遊戲目前是最熱門的遊戲,很多熱播的電視劇或者電影之後,都會有相同情節的手游上線。

    伺服器主流的開發語言是 C++ 和 Java,但是 C++ 學習難度大,開發速度慢。一般來說我們都是使用Java語言來開發伺服器。

  • 8 # 小螞蟻教你做遊戲

    對於從未接觸過遊戲開發的新手來講,最好的學習做遊戲的方式就是選擇一個簡單易上手的遊戲製作工具,然後直接上手去做一個簡單的遊戲。

    透過親自動手製作遊戲來體驗遊戲開發的整個過程,這樣才能夠清楚自己是否是真正的喜歡做遊戲。我寫了一個專門面向新手的遊戲開發系列教程《人人都能做遊戲》,即使是沒有任何的遊戲開發經驗,不會程式設計,也能跟隨著教程一步一步的做出自己的第一個小遊戲。

    希望這個入門教程能夠幫助你順利的進入遊戲開發世界的大門。

  • 9 # 逗號遊戲開發

    首先我要說的是: 進入遊戲行業,一定要記住,是真的喜歡遊戲,這個點很重要。

    入行遊戲開發,其實和普通開發沒有什麼區別,我們一起來分析一下。

    (1) 選擇一個開發工具與框架平臺,學習相關工具和程式語言以及相關平臺的庫。

    如遊戲客戶端Unity引擎,學習C#,然後熟練的掌握Unity來開發遊戲。

    如遊戲服務端,選擇Java,學習Java與主流的Java框架,如netty等。

    (2) 掌握資料結構與演算法,演算法和資料結構是程式的靈魂,決定了你程式碼的高度。

    (3) 學習遊戲開發中一些常用的技術,比如網路同步,渲染等等。

    (4) 學會遊戲的專案管理與團隊管理;

    這裡每一個點都有對應的一些知識點和要學習的內容,具體可以我主頁裡面看看教程,可以發對應的知識體系給大家參考。

  • 10 # 我是一個西瓜w

    現在遊戲製作這個行業是一個非常有前景的朝陽行業,做這個行業的人,目前在我們國家的薪水都是頂級的,而這方面的人才卻很稀少。大學裡也很少開設這種遊戲製作的課程,即便是有,很多老師的水平基本上也就是一些理論派,沒什麼乾貨。其實很多人想做這個行業,於是從網上扒拉各種遊戲製作教程學習,學了半天也是一頭霧水,稀裡糊塗,說不會吧,還真會,說會吧,水平還真不咋地。學的東西太雜亂無章,沒有什麼系統,缺乏真功夫,很難在遊戲製作這個行業裡立足,這是我們很多遊戲學習行業人員的悲哀。

  • 11 # 江西新華阿然

    現在遊戲製作這個行業是一個非常有前景的朝陽行業,做這個行業的人,目前在我們國家的薪水都是頂級的,而這方面的人才卻很稀少。

  • 中秋節和大豐收的關聯?
  • 我的世界網易版如何定座標?